Role Purpose
The Legal Counsel – Express UK&I provides broad commercial and regulatory legal support to the Express business across the UK and Ireland. You will operate as a trusted adviser to senior leadership teams, operational functions, product teams, commercial colleagues, and the Compliance organisation, where required.
This role requires strong business intimacy, excellent judgment, and the ability to deliver pragmatic, actionable advice at speed — fully aligned with the “One Legal Team committed to accelerate sustainable growth” vision.
The role reports into the Head of Legal – Express UK&I, as part of a small, dedicated and highly collaborative commercial legal team, including a Senior Legal Counsel.
Key Responsibilities
* Advise and counsel senior leaders and line management to ensure current or proposed business activities, policies, practices and transactions comply with relevant laws and regulations
* Review legal analyses and technical reports to recommend a response to legal issues or proposed changes in laws and regulations
* Draft, negotiate and advise on a wide range of commercial agreements, including: transportation and logistics service agreements; supplier contracts; local/global sponsorship and partnership agreements; cross‑border and customs-related services, to protect the organization’s legal and commercial interests.
* Support major tenders, strategic customer and supplier opportunities and network transformation projects.
* Provide clear, commercially‑grounded advice that balances legal risk with operational realities and business growth.
* Provide Company Secretarial services as and when required on behalf of certain Group entities within the UK.
* Support and respond to commercial litigation or other specialized proceedings brought against DHL Group, managing external counsel resources as and when necessary.
* Coach less experienced legal staff and help them resolve problems
* Conduct work associated with Legal Counsel, Legal Research & Document Drafting, Contract Negotiation & Administration and Legal Records Management
* Use legal tech, matter management and data tools to support speed, efficiency and visibility; and promote legal self‑service where appropriate (e.g., NDAs, standard terms).
* Maintain a “first‑choice mindset” by continuously improving how Legal supports network operations and commercial teams.
* Participate in DHL Group Practice Groups and Centres of Excellence.
* Support the development of colleagues through knowledge sessions, playbook development and best‑practice sharing.
Your Profile
* UK qualified solicitor with 4+ years’ post-qualification experience.
* Strong commercial contracts experience gained in-house and/or private practice.
* Commercially minded, pragmatic and decisive, with the confidence to advise independently.
* Experience working within a global matrix organization.
* Experience in aviation, transport, logistics, supply chain, postal, or FMCG sectors, preferred but not essential.
* Good understanding of ESG issues relevant to transport and logistics (emissions, supply chain integrity, sustainability commitments), preferred but not essential.
* Able to manage priorities effectively and perform well under time pressure.
* Demonstrates professionalism, integrity and sound judgment, with the gravitas to engage senior stakeholders.
